
如何安装Excel API 函数库
安装Excel API 函数库主要包括以下步骤:选择合适的API、下载相应的库文件、配置Excel、测试API功能。在这些步骤中,选择合适的API尤为重要,因为它直接影响到你后续的使用和开发效果。合适的API不仅能够提供丰富的函数和功能,还能够确保与现有系统的兼容性和稳定性。
一、选择合适的API
选择合适的Excel API函数库是成功安装和使用的关键。市面上有多种Excel API可供选择,包括官方的Microsoft Excel API、第三方库如Openpyxl、XlsxWriter等。每种API都有其独特的功能和适用场景。Microsoft Excel API是官方提供的,功能全面且更新及时,但通常需要授权和支付费用。Openpyxl和XlsxWriter是开源的,适合预算有限或需要特定功能的用户。
- Microsoft Excel API:提供了最全面的功能,适合需要高级操作和专业应用的用户。其优势在于官方支持和丰富的文档资源。
- Openpyxl:这是一个非常流行的开源库,特别适合处理Excel 2010及以上版本的文件。它支持读写Excel文件,并且可以进行复杂的操作如公式计算、图表创建等。
- XlsxWriter:这个库专注于写操作,适合生成复杂的Excel报表。它支持多种格式和样式,但读操作功能相对有限。
二、下载相应的库文件
选定API后,下一步是下载相应的库文件。不同的API有不同的下载和安装方式。以下是一些常见API的下载方法:
- Microsoft Excel API:可以通过Microsoft官方网站进行下载,通常需要注册和获取API密钥。根据你的开发环境选择合适的版本(如Windows、MacOS等)。
- Openpyxl:可以通过Python的包管理器pip进行安装,命令如下:
pip install openpyxl - XlsxWriter:同样可以通过pip进行安装,命令如下:
pip install XlsxWriter
三、配置Excel
下载并安装完API库文件后,需要进行相关配置以便在Excel中使用。不同的API库配置步骤有所不同,以下是一些常见的配置方法:
-
Microsoft Excel API:通常需要在Excel中启用开发者选项,并在VBA编辑器中导入API库。具体步骤如下:
- 打开Excel,点击“文件”菜单,选择“选项”。
- 在选项窗口中,选择“自定义功能区”,在右侧列表中勾选“开发工具”。
- 返回主界面,点击“开发工具”选项卡,选择“Visual Basic”。
- 在VBA编辑器中,选择“工具”菜单,点击“引用”,在弹出的窗口中选择你下载的API库文件。
-
Openpyxl和XlsxWriter:作为Python库,它们不需要在Excel中进行配置,但需要在Python环境中进行设置。以下是一个简单的例子,展示如何使用Openpyxl读写Excel文件:
import openpyxl读取Excel文件
workbook = openpyxl.load_workbook('example.xlsx')
sheet = workbook.active
写入数据
sheet['A1'] = 'Hello, World!'
workbook.save('example.xlsx')
四、测试API功能
配置完成后,最后一步是测试API的功能。通过一些简单的操作验证API是否能够正常工作。以下是一些常见的测试方法:
-
Microsoft Excel API:在VBA编辑器中编写简单的宏,调用API函数来操作Excel文件。例如,创建一个新的工作表、写入数据、保存文件等。
Sub TestAPI()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ets.Add
ws.Name = "TestSheet"
ws.Cells(1, 1).Value = "Hello, World!"
End Sub
-
Openpyxl和XlsxWriter:在Python脚本中编写简单的代码,测试读写Excel文件的功能。例如,创建一个新的Excel文件、写入数据、读取数据等。
import xlsxwriter创建一个新的Excel文件和工作表
workbook = xlsxwriter.Workbook('test.xlsx')
worksheet = workbook.add_worksheet()
写入数据
worksheet.write('A1', 'Hello, World!')
workbook.close()
通过以上步骤,你应该能够成功安装并使用Excel API函数库。不同的API有不同的使用方法和优势,选择合适的API可以极大地提高工作效率和开发质量。
五、常见问题及解决方法
尽管安装和使用Excel API函数库相对简单,但在实际操作中可能会遇到一些问题。以下是一些常见问题及其解决方法:
1、API库下载失败
有时由于网络问题或其他原因,下载API库文件可能会失败。解决方法包括:检查网络连接、使用代理服务器、尝试不同的下载源等。
2、库文件导入失败
在Excel或Python环境中导入库文件时,可能会遇到库文件导入失败的问题。解决方法包括:检查文件路径、确保文件完整性、更新软件版本等。
3、API函数调用失败
在调用API函数时,可能会遇到函数调用失败的问题。解决方法包括:检查函数参数、参考API文档、查看错误日志等。
六、提高使用效率的技巧
在安装和使用Excel API函数库后,提高使用效率也是非常重要的。以下是一些提高使用效率的技巧:
1、使用模板文件
在进行重复性操作时,可以使用模板文件来提高效率。模板文件可以包含预定义的样式、格式和函数,避免每次操作都从头开始。
2、批量处理数据
在处理大量数据时,可以使用批量处理的方法来提高效率。例如,使用循环语句一次性处理多个单元格的数据,而不是逐个处理。
3、优化代码性能
在编写代码时,注意优化代码性能。例如,避免重复计算、使用高效的数据结构、减少不必要的I/O操作等。
七、应用场景及案例分析
Excel API函数库在各种应用场景中都可以发挥重要作用。以下是几个典型的应用场景及案例分析:
1、财务报表生成
在财务报表生成中,Excel API函数库可以用于自动化报表生成、数据汇总、图表创建等。通过编写脚本,可以快速生成复杂的财务报表,提高工作效率。
2、数据分析与可视化
在数据分析与可视化中,Excel API函数库可以用于数据读取、清洗、分析和可视化。通过API函数,可以轻松实现数据的自动化处理和可视化展示。
3、项目管理
在项目管理中,Excel API函数库可以用于项目计划、任务分配、进度跟踪等。通过API函数,可以实现项目管理的自动化,提高项目管理的效率和精度。
在项目管理中,推荐使用研发项目管理系统PingCode和通用项目协作软件Worktile。这些系统提供了强大的项目管理功能,可以与Excel API函数库结合使用,实现项目管理的自动化和精细化。
八、总结
安装Excel API函数库是一个系统性的过程,包括选择合适的API、下载相应的库文件、配置Excel、测试API功能等。通过这些步骤,可以成功安装并使用Excel API函数库,提高工作效率和开发质量。在实际操作中,注意解决常见问题、提高使用效率,并结合具体的应用场景,充分发挥Excel API函数库的优势。
相关问答FAQs:
1. 什么是Excel API函数库?
Excel API函数库是一组预定义的函数和功能,可以与Microsoft Excel软件集成,以扩展其功能。它提供了各种用于数据处理、计算和分析的功能,可以帮助用户更高效地操作和处理Excel表格数据。
2. 我需要哪些步骤来安装Excel API函数库?
安装Excel API函数库非常简单。首先,您需要确保已经安装了Microsoft Excel软件。然后,您可以按照以下步骤进行安装:
- 打开Excel软件并创建一个新的工作簿。
- 点击顶部菜单栏中的“文件”选项。
- 在下拉菜单中选择“选项”。
- 在选项窗口中,选择“加载项”选项。
- 点击“Excel加载项”旁边的“转到”按钮。
- 在“加载项”窗口中,点击“浏览”按钮。
- 浏览到Excel API函数库的安装文件,并选择它。
- 点击“确定”按钮,然后按照提示完成安装过程。
3. 安装Excel API函数库后,我可以做什么?
安装Excel API函数库后,您将获得许多强大的功能和功能,可以用于处理和分析Excel表格数据。您可以使用这些函数来进行数据的筛选、排序、计算、图表生成等操作。您还可以使用API函数来连接外部数据源,自动更新数据,并创建自定义的报表和分析工具。无论是进行简单的数据处理还是复杂的数据分析,Excel API函数库都可以帮助您提高工作效率并获得更好的结果。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/3390655